F&B ASSISTANT

24,450 per annum + monthly service charge & excellent benefits
Located right on the river edge in the centre of Royal Windsor, Sir Christopher Wren Hotel & Spa is a popular four star hotel in an unbeatable setting. Comprised of several characterful buildings clustered around a historic cobbled street by Eton Bridge, the hotel offers a collection of individually styled bedrooms, a modern conference centre, The Brasserie restaurant and bar, and the Wren’s Club spa and fitness centre. The perfect riverside location is just steps from Windsor Castle, and is popular for tourists as well as visitors for meetings and events.
We’re looking for a positive and friendly individual to join our busy Food & Beverage Team, working in our Brasserie Restaurant & Bar and Meeting & Events spaces. This role is available on either a Full Time (40 Hours a week) or Casual basis. Please state in your application which you are looking for.
Our Food & Beverage Team is at the heart of our business and as our new Food & Beverage Assistant you’ll be providing excellent levels of service and a good knowledge of food and drink to our guests in our Brasserie and Meeting and Events spaces. Being in a customer-facing role means you’ll be confident and well-presented with a warm way with people.

Responsibilities
  • Providing a welcoming and friendly atmosphere for our guests, recognising and acknowledging them and using their name during interactions.
  • Learning and building knowledge of our food, drinks and other products and services.
  • Helping our customers to enjoy their experience by using your knowledge and passion of our products to deliver excellent service levels
  • Being proactive in up selling all aspects of the department.
  • Maintaining work areas and equipment ensuring they are kept functional and orderly at all times and meet all hygiene and health & safety regulations.
  • Working well with your colleagues to ensure a smooth service and high team morale.
  • Attending training & completing e-learning modules to improve your skills and aid your development
